400.494 Information about patients confidential.
(1) Information about patients received by persons employed by, or providing services to, a home health agency or received by the licensing agency through reports or inspection shall be confidential and exempt from the provisions of s. 119.07(1) and shall only be disclosed to any person, other than the patient, as permitted under the provisions of 45 C.F.R. ss. 160.102, 160.103, and 164, subpart A, commonly referred to as the HIPAA Privacy Regulation; except that clinical records described in ss. 381.004, 384.29, 385.202, 392.65, 394.4615, 395.404, 397.501, and 760.40 shall be disclosed as authorized in those sections.
(2) This section does not apply to information lawfully requested by the Medicaid Fraud Control Unit of the Department of Legal Affairs.
History.s. 48, ch. 75-233; s. 2, ch. 81-318; ss. 79, 83, ch. 83-181; s. 20, ch. 90-347; s. 23, ch. 93-214; s. 229, ch. 96-406; s. 4, ch. 2000-163; s. 7, ch. 2005-243.
